Hi,
I have some problem with ordering of the new batteries for this device and the old one's completely unusable. Is it possible to turn off somehow that per second beeping? I have this message in my log: "UPS: The battery is not installed properly" and battery indicator blinking (on the front panel).

Hi Alex,
If that option doesn't disable the beep for your situation, then there won't be a way to. Like I said, we don't typically allow this type of thing since the batteries are a crticial part of the UPS functioning so we want to constantly remind (annoy) the user or else they have no battery back up. I suggested double checking it since I did see a different UPS, one with SUA model prefix, seemed to apply this setting and mute this disconnected battery beep going against what I just said
Unfortunately too, online models like SURT (and SRT) models need good batteries to turn on. You'll need to get it some good batteries to get it turned on again. I'd say put it in bypass as other models would work like that but this model has an electronic bypass so it would also require good batteries to engage the bypass function.

I am not 100% sure if that specific alarm can be disabled but critical battery alarms like that typically cannot be since the battery is the lifeblood of the UPS. If there is any chance of disabling it, you'd see the option within the UPS Network Management Card menu with the other UPS options. Do you have access to that management card? This UPS would include one by default.
